Healthcare facilities manage thousands of vendor visits annually from medical reps to contractors. Ensuring every vendor meets compliance standards is critical for patient safety, regulatory compliance, and operational efficiency.

Traditional vendor credentialing relies on annual or static background checks, creating visibility gaps that may expose hospitals to risk.

Why Traditional Credentialing Falls Short

Most healthcare systems still depend on periodic screenings, which can lead to:

  • Limited visibility between checks

  • Delayed risk identification

  • Increased administrative workload

  • Fragmented compliance tracking

In high-risk hospital environments, real-time monitoring is no longer optional—it’s essential.
